| Eco-Friendly Water Management Specialist (Gyms) |
Develops and implements water-saving strategies for gyms, reducing consumption and operational costs while minimizing environmental impact. Focuses on water treatment and purification for pools and spas. |
| Sustainable Pool & Spa Technician |
Maintains and repairs gym pool and spa equipment, emphasizing energy-efficient operations and minimizing chemical usage. Expertise in water filtration and chemical balancing is key. |
| Water Audit & Consultancy (Fitness Facilities) |
Conducts water audits for gyms, identifying areas for improvement and recommending cost-effective, eco-friendly solutions. Provides expert advice on water conservation technologies. |

A Certified Professional in Eco-Friendly Water Solutions for Gym Facilities certification program equ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to implement sustainable water management practices within fitness centers. This includes understanding water conservation techniques, treatment methods, and the use of eco-friendly cleaning products.
Learning outcomes encompass the design and implementation of water-efficient plumbing systems, the selection and maintenance of water-saving fixtures, and the identification and remediation of water leaks. Participants will also gain proficiency in chemical-free pool maintenance, greywater recycling, and the overall reduction of a gym's water footprint.
The program duration varies depending on the provider, typically ranging from a few days to several weeks of intensive training, combining theoretical knowledge with practical, hands-on exercises. Some programs may include online modules alongside in-person workshops.
